Asparagus (Shatavari) 60S is a dietary supplement containing 60 capsules, each formulated with 250 mg of Asparagus root extract, commonly known as Shatavari. Shatavari, scientifically named *Asparagus racemosus*, is a climbing plant native to the Indian subcontinent and is traditionally used in Ayurvedic medicine. **Primary Uses:**
Shatavari is renowned for its benefits in supporting women’s health, particularly in promoting healthy lactation and overall reproductive well-being. It is also considered a rejuvenative tonic, aiding in post-delivery recovery and enhancing vitality. **Drug Class:**
Shatavari is classified as a herbal supplement and is not categorized under conventional pharmaceutical drug classes.
**Mechanism of Action:**
The active compounds in Shatavari, such as saponins, alkaloids, proteins, and tannins, are believed to support the body’s natural production of estrogen, thereby promoting hormonal balance and reproductive health. **Common Forms:**
Shatavari is available in various forms, including capsules, tablets, powders, and liquid extracts. The 60S variant refers to a bottle containing 60 capsules.

**Side Effects, Contraindications, and Interactions:**
Shatavari is generally considered safe for most adults when used appropriately. However, individuals with known allergies to asparagus or related plants should exercise caution. Pregnant or breastfeeding women should consult a healthcare professional before using this supplement. As with any herbal supplement, it is important to consult with a healthcare provider before starting Shatavari, especially if you have existing health conditions or are taking other medications.
